Maldini in Istanbul
Presidential candidate Hakan Safi has met with Paolo Maldini in Istanbul, and Italian media are now reporting Maldini could reunite with his former AC Milan colleague Stefano Pioli at Fenerbahçe if Safi wins the election. The pair ended Milan's long Scudetto drought together in 2022. Maldini would take on a sporting director role, with Pioli as head coach. (1) (3)
Aziz promises two strikers
Aziz Yıldırım went on live TV and made it blunt: "We will sign at least two strikers." He's campaigning hard on halting what he calls a 12-year decline. One name floating around is a French-based forward, though nothing is confirmed yet. (4) (6)
Kante could be moved on
If Yıldırım wins, N'Golo Kanté's time might be up. His salary package reportedly costs the club 88.6 million euros, and Yıldırım is prepared to part ways to free up serious transfer budget. Nothing decided yet, but the numbers make it a live possibility. (2)
Safi: two meetings today
Safi told reporters he held two transfer-related meetings today, fueling excitement among supporters. He also doubled down on his vision: "We will bring the world stars Fenerbahçe needs and integrate them into the club." He specifically referenced the new 10+4 foreign player rule as part of his plan.
